Nurse Practitioner Hourly Pay in Roseville, CA: $85.20 (2026)
Quick Answer:Hourly pay for a nurse practitioner working in Roseville, CA runs $85.20 at the median for 2026 — annualizing to $177,211 at a standard 2,080-hour year. Figures proj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1171). Weighted against Roseville's regional price level (BEA RPP 113.1, 13% above national), each hour of work buys what $75.33 nationally would. A 24-hour part-time schedule grosses $106,331 per year.

In Roseville, California, the median hourly pay for nurse practitioners is projected to reach $85.20 in 2026, significantly higher than the national hourly median of $65.80. This difference highlights the strong demand for healthcare services in the region, encouraging many practitioners to consider part-time roles or per-diem assignments at facilities like primary care clinics, urgent care centers, and telehealth platforms. For those working part-time, such as three days a week, this translates into an income based on 24 hours per week, positioning them between the lower end of the entry-level pay range of $66.99 and the higher tier of $115.94. The extensive hourly range of $66.99 (P10) to $115.94 (P90) further indicates the wide variations in earnings available to nurse practitioners as they advance their careers and specialize in areas like mental health or emergency care.

Nurse Practitioner Hourly Wage Breakdown
| Percentile | Hourly Rate | Per 8hr Shift |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Level (P10) | $66.99 | $535.95 |
| Lower Range (P25) | $76.95 | $615.57 |
| Median (P50) | $85.20 | $681.61 |
| Upper Range (P75) | $100.03 | $800.21 |
| Top Earners (P90) | $115.94 | $927.49 |

Hourly Rate Trajectory for Nurse Practitioners in Roseville (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.45% projection.
| Year | Hourly Rate |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$68.37/hr | Actual |
| 2020 | $69.52/hr | Actual |
| 2021 | $75.13/hr | Actual |
| 2022 | $75.71/hr | Actual |
| 2023 | $78.60/hr | Actual |
| 2024 | $89.70/hr | Actual |
| 2025 | $82.36/hr |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$85.20/hr | Estimated |
| 2027 | $88.14/hr |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S metropolitan area data, the median hourly rate for nurse practitioners in Roseville grew 20.5% from $68.37/hr (2019) to $82.36/hr (2025). At a 3.45% projected growth rate, hourly pay is expected to reach $88.14/hr by 2027. Working as an Hourly Nurse Practitioner in Roseville
For nurse practitioners on a part-time schedule, focusing on just three days a week can yield an annual income of approximately $106,785, which still reflects a substantial earning opportunity but is notably less than a full-time NP’s earning potential. The landscape for per diem nurse practitioners in Roseville is particularly lucrative, with rates often exceeding standard wages; locum tenens nurse practitioners can charge between $80 and $140 per hour depending on their specialty, while psychiatric mental health nurse practitioners (PMHNPs) operating through telehealth frequently earn up to $200 per hour. This variance in pay can be attributed to employer types across Roseville, including urgent care chains and retail clinics, where benefits may influence job choice. Many NPs must weigh hourly rates against the benefits offered; accepting a lower hourly rate might come with health insurance and other perks, whereas opting for higher rates could mean fewer benefits. For those negotiating their pay, understanding these dynamics is crucial. More experienced nurse practitioners may find the best success by proposing rates that reflect their specialized skills or the added value they bring to an organization.
